There are some ground-breaking advances in tile technology. Increasingly large tile formats, the ability of porcelain to expertly imitate other materials and advances in tiles finishes to name a few. Porcelain is transforming how we might approach the design of spaces. Discover Italian concrete look porcelain tiles It’s one of the leading design trends in recent years but it’s origins are firmly rooted in the past. The trend for ‘concrete look porcelain tiles’ owes its extraordinary popularity to the architectural movements of the 1950s and 60s in the form of Brutalism.
